It\'s not \'Rosie\', it\'s your BOINC. It\'s got more work than it can handle, and won\'t allow anything else to download.

It will stay like that for days, or even weeks, and then, when it\'s worked out a \'work schedule\' to include both climate models and other projects, it\'ll suddenly realise that things aren\'t as bad as it first thought, and allow work from other projects.

This is normal for computers running other projects that suddenly find a climate model added to the mix.

It also seems that you haven\'t altered your preference settings in your climate project account to select the type of model that\'s sent to you.
If you do this, you can get shorter models, so that other projects don\'t suffer.

And if you start turning the climate models on and off so as to allow work from other projects, you\'ll just prolong the time that it takes BOINC to create its \'work schedule\'.

PS
Don\'t get lulled into thinking that the climate models aren\'t needed for 3 years.
That\'s just to fool BOINC into not panicing. The models are required ASAP. Leave some of them too long, and the research for that model type may well be over and done with before you finish the model.

> Margo B:
>
> Generally what you wrote in your other message about Daily quota exceeded is a
> message that you receive as you computer has tried to download over 2 models
> in one day. Generally this indicates that the previous 2 models that it
> downloaded have crashed and you would have seen in the Boinc "Messages" tab
> some information about an error code. From the above it appears that the
> computer keeps crashing the models daily.
>
> I am not familiar with the text that you have pasted in so I cannot comment
> further though it does seem that your computer was running models
> successfully. Have you made any changes to your system on or just before Oct
> 6?
>
> Another thought, do you have the option to "Leave applications in memory while
> preempted" set to Yes? I think I read somewhere that have a "No" to this
> could have negative results.
>
> You might want to try looking at some of the stickies and other information on
> the Climateprediction.net discussion forum at:
> http://www.climateprediction.net/board/index.php
>
> Which is accessable from the "Message Boards" menu item on the left hand side.
> There could be some systems stability or other issues that could be looked
> into.
>
> DaveN
